(a)If a partner is dissociated from a partnership without resulting in a dissolution and winding up of the partnership business under § 29-608.01 , the partnership shall cause the dissociated partner’s interest in the partnership to be purchased for a buyout price determined pursuant to subsection (b) of this section.
(b)The buyout price of a dissociated partner’s interest shall be the amount that would have been distributable to the dissociating partner under § 29-608.07(b) if, on the date of dissociation, the assets of the partnership were sold at a price equal to the greater of the liquidation value or the value based on a sale of the entire business as a going concern without the dissociated partner and the partnership were wound up as of that date.
